Things to do in Orlando

Orlando, "The Capital of Theme Parks", also offers its visitors the best of designer shopping and cuisine. Street shopping and local boutiques are a bigger attraction than the mega malls. Visit Lake Buena Vista for a fine dining experience. You can also tuck into one of the local neighbourhoods for an all American platter. Get going and have a great time at Orlando.

Take at least a week off to explore and relax with the following:

  • Master the wizardry world of Harry Potter at Universal's Island of Adventure
  • Buy a couple of days' ticket to the best themed park in the world - Walt Disney World
  • Get up close with the dolphins, stingrays and exotic birds at the Discovery Cove
  • At the Pirate's Cove enjoy the pirate dungeon and the waterfalls along with a relaxed game of golf
  • Take an amazing virtual tour to the moon and back, then enjoy the Kennedy Space Centre
  • Watch the beautiful Orlando sunrise and a slow drifting journey high up over the city in a hot air balloon
  • Explore sea and marine life and enjoy a host of water rides in SeaWorld Adventure Park
  • Visit Gatorland, which is a treasure trove of sea reptiles like crocodiles, toads, alligators and snakes
  • Shopping is a never-ending activity when in the Mall at Millenia or at the various malls and factory outlets
  • Tee off and relax at the Grand Cyprus Golf Club along with the likes of Tiger Woods and other pros

Orlando Airports

There are 2 major international airports in Orlando. The Orlando International Airport caters to all international airlines whereas the Orlando Sanford International Airport caters to domestic and budget airlines.

Orlando Sanford International Airport

Top Carriers
This airport is used by budget airlines and some European carriers: allegiant Airlines , TUIfly and Thomson Airways.
Location
This airport is a 27 km drive from the city centre.
Transportation
There are number of taxi, limousine and shuttle services from the airport which will connect you to the city centre. A number of car rental offices can be found in the arrival areas airport terminals.
